==FINAL FINAL EDIT==

So i now found the error. I just noticed that i loaded in the cis_inf_b1_1.req the wrong odf file. so the munge worked. But i now know the error. The cis_inf_b1_1.req calls cis_inf_b1_1.odf and this opens the cis_weap_E5.odf and now comes the problem the cis_weap_E5.odf calls as Ordnance itselfe. So it was an infinite loop while mungeing and windows stoped it. And than there was this missing breaked, because munge.exe couldn't finish the task
